The San Diego Unified School District Visual and Performing Arts Department supports all district students in dance, theatre, music, and visual art. California State funding for the arts is lower than ever and in some districts, the visual and performing arts have been eliminated from public schools altogether.

But the arts are alive in SDUSD and we want to keep them that way. The Board of Education agreed to restore 26 elementary music teachers that serve 120 elementary schools in our district (100%). But there is no funding for music supplies, method books, instrument repairs, and equipment.



According to the National Association of Music Merchants (NAMM) students who are provided music instruction in school:

- have improved attendance

- have fewer discipline problems

- are less likely to drop out

- do better in math and reading

- attend college at twice the rate

- perform better in world languages

- score better on standardized tests

- feel better about themselves

...compared to students who do not participate in music instruction.
